Women on the Way provides services that enhance and empower adult learners’ abilities to achieve academic, professional and personal success. The program provides resources and support for SPC students seeking to complete a college degree:
- Scholarships
- Peer Support
- Advising
- Seminars
- Workshops
- Textbooks
- College and community resources information
Based on the Clearwater Campus, our facilities include a lounge where students can relax, unwind, make friends and share experiences.

The following services are available to active members:
- Academic advising
Help students with class selection and schedule selection.
- Clothing boutique
Provide a clothing boutique of gently worn clothing from the community, faculty, staff and students.
- Emergency toiletries
Personal hygiene items such as toilet paper, paper towels, shampoo, laundry detergent, etc. are available depending on resources.
- Peer support
Students can support and build camaraderie with one another.
- Newsletter and calendar of events
- Study room and lounge area
Students have a place to relax and make friends.
- Weekly workshops (Lunch Bunches)
Held on Mondays and Tuesdays, 12:30-1:30 p.m., WOW participants are given information on topics such as time and stress management, career development and success strategies that they can use in their personal and professional lives.
- College and community resources information
A list of Human Services and Social Services Contact Guide is available with contact information for food shelters, homeless shelters, housing and child care.
- Scholarships
Active members are eligible to apply for WOW scholarships after one term of enrollment.
- Positive Directions Association
Positive Directions Association is the Women on the Way campus club for its members. The club sponsors fundraisers to secure items such as textbooks for active members. It meets once a month during the fall and spring terms. The club is located on the Clearwater campus and encourages students to enhance leadership skills, develop teamwork skills, improve self-esteem, meet other students,
enjoy group activities, and add fun to their college experiences.
- Textbook lending library
Club fundraisers and community donations help provide textbooks to members.
